Honor’s New Smartphone Line ‘Win’ Set to Challenge Rivals with Power and Innovation

Honor has officially announced an entirely new line of smartphones, and yes, it is indeed named the Win series. After several months of rumors, the company finally confirmed the name by releasing the first teaser. On December 16, new smartphones will be presented at an event under the slogan “Exceptional strength, born to win.” It is expected that the Honor Win series will replace the Honor GT line, which, in turn, debuted only in 2024. The next phone, which many expected to see under the name Honor GT 2, is now reportedly going to be released under the name Win.

Render CNMO

Rumors suggest that the lineup will feature two devices named Honor Win and Honor Win Pro. The standard Honor Win model is reportedly coming in several colors, including beige, black, white, and blue. Meanwhile, the Honor Win Pro will also get an integrated cooling element near the top camera lens.

The Honor Win may operate on the Snapdragon 8 Elite SoC, while the Win Pro is expected to use the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5. The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 is designed for enhanced performance with improved AI capabilities, making it suitable for gaming enthusiasts and tech-savvy users. Both phones are expected to feature a 1.5K OLED display, a 50-megapixel main camera, and a robust 8,500 mAh battery with 100W fast charging support. They will receive a metal body and advanced water resistance, ensuring durability and reliability.
